Manual:
Go to Start/Run/CMD and type in: cd c:\ <enter>, systeminfo. System Type
will probably read: X86
Or go to Start/Run/Regedit and navigate to this key:
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Contro l\Session
Manager\Environment. In the right pane: Processor_Architecture should
read: x86 for 32 bit.
